Before diving into the latest trends, it's essential to understand what "highly compressed" actually means for PSX games. Unlike modern games that often come in massive, high-definition packages, PSX discs contain a mix of data, audio tracks, and video files. Specialized compression techniques target these different data types to achieve maximum space savings without sacrificing gameplay.

Older high-compression methods often remove high-quality audio (BGM) and video sequences (FMVs) to reduce file size. For example, games like Tekken 3 can be reduced from 600MB to 70MB, but at the cost of losing soundtracks and cinematic sequences. How to Compress to PBP using PSX2PSP Before
These are exact copies of the original PlayStation discs. The .BIN file contains the actual game data, while the .CUE file is a text file tells the emulator how to read the tracks. These files are uncompressed and take up the most space. 2. The Gold Standard: .CHD (Compressed Hunks of Data)
